Sheila Whiteman is an experienced human resources professional with a diverse background spanning over three decades in various senior HR roles. Currently serving as the Head of Human Resources at Freespace since October 2020, Sheila previously held multiple positions including Senior Human Resources Business Partner and HR Manager. Prior to Freespace, Sheila worked as an HR Business Partner at Maximus UK and an HR Manager at Capita. Significant experience includes a role as Senior HR Business Partner at Interserve Facilities Services, where Sheila was part of the senior management team overseeing 2,500 employees after the acquisition of Initial Facilities. Earlier career highlights include over five years at Rentokil Initial as Senior HR Manager, where Sheila supported various business sectors with large employee bases, as well as a decade at William Hill as HR Manager. Sheila's career commenced at Dewsbury Further Education College, evolving from a Senior Staffing Officer to setting up staffing units. Educational credentials include a CIPD degree from Huddersfield University.
Sign up to view 2 direct reports
Get started
This person is not in any teams